Marketing Budget Cut — FY Notes (Managers Only)

Quick rundown for the incoming director: the Hollyfort campaign budget got trimmed by about a third after the Q1 review at Drayben & Sons. Sponsorships are paused, the Westmere launch event is cancelled, and social spend is consolidated under one agency. Teams have taken it reasonably well, though the field reps are grumbling. Don't announce anything yet — there's a bigger picture. The confidential note explaining it sits just below.

management briefing: Project Ulavan slips by two quarters because of the staffing delay.

## Quartzline Environments — Replica Lag Alarm

The read-replica lag alarm fires when the Quartzline reporting replica falls behind primary beyond threshold. Staging tolerates more lag than prod; don't copy thresholds between environments. Alarm routes to the data-platform rotation. If it flaps during nightly batch loads, check the Skarn ETL window before tuning anything. Silencing longer than one hour requires a note in the ops log. Current thresholds and related settings are as follows.

config for kafof-bawef:
holath:
  log_level: debug
  metrics_host: metrics.holath.qorvelsys.internal
  pin: 2191
  pool_size: 32

Subject: DR drill findings — Lumenkit SDK parity

Team,

During last week's disaster-recovery drill we restored both the Lumenkit Swift and Kotlin SDK pipelines from cold backups. Feature parity held except for the offline cache module, now tracked separately. Future maintainers rerunning this drill will need to unlock the parity test vault before validation. The vault accepts the recovery passphrase below:

vault phrase of hafog-bajop = sorael-novath-drumir-rusius-praix-kasox-joreth-belion-istwyn-belael-zorok-gorael-norir